单词 furcula
释义

furculan.

/ˈfəːkjʊlə/
Etymology: < Latin furcula, diminutive of furca fork.
1. Ornithology. A forked bone below the neck of a bird, consisting of the two clavicles and an inter-clavicle; the merrythought or wishbone.

1859 C. Darwin Origin of Species (1878) i. 16 Relative size of the two arms of the furcula.
1868 C. Darwin Variation Animals & Plants I. v. 175 The sternum, scapulæ, and furcula are all reduced in proportional length.
1903 J. S. Kingsley tr. Hertwig Man. Zool. 605 Clavicles and furcula are united directly or by ligaments to the broad sternum.
1954 G. C. Kent Compar. Anat. Vertebr. viii. 253 The two clavicles unite in the midline to form a furcula (wishbone).
2. Embryology. A process from which the epiglottis is developed.

1887 A. C. Haddon Introd. Study Embryol. vi. 183 Behind this [projection] are a pair of folds (furcula), which eventually will form the epiglottis.
1893 A. M. Marshall Vertebr. Embryol. 562 Along the middle of this swelling, or furcula, there runs a longitudinal groove.
1926 H. E. Jordan & J. E. Kindred Textbk. Embryol. xv. 196 The crest of the furcula becomes elevated and develops into the epiglottis.
3. Entomology. A forked appendage at the end of the abdomen in springtails.

1871 Amer. Naturalist 5 10 The spring consists of a pair of three-jointed appendages..forming a fork.]
1906 J. W. Folsom Entomol. ii. 68 Appendages... In Collembola..those of the fourth segment form the characteristic leaping organ, or furcula.
1909 Jrnl. Econ. Bot. 4 9 Furcula somewhat broader than in S[minthurus] aureus.
1932 L. A. Borradaile & F. A. Potts Invertebrata xiv. 408 By contraction of the extensor muscles of the furcula the latter is pulled down out of contact with the hamula and the animal is propelled forwards into the air.
1964 J. T. Salmon Index to Collembola I. 111 Re-examination showed this species to have a well developed furcula.
